With the 25th annual Sandestin Gumbo Festival coming up I thought I would ask - what local restaurant has a great bowl of gumbo? Who has your favorite? Stinky's, Grayton Bar & Grill, Marigny ... ????

Let's start a SoWal List of grayt GUMBO.

I love many good bowls in the area, especially 98 BBQ! John won the gumbo festival for 5 years in a row.
